Acid test for Raila Odinga, William Ruto amid fears of a possible low voter turnout

Independent Electoral Boundaries Commission personnel wait for potential voters to register themselves at Whispers Ground in Nyeri. [Kibata Kihu, Standard]

The electoral body has started a race for numbers after the latest register released on Wednesday showed there were 22 million voters.

And as the presidential candidates ramp up campaigns with the clock ticking towards August 9, the next worry is how to convince voters to turn out and cast their ballots.
